Bachelor's degree in biology or in geology with a strong focus on paleontology. If you have not finished your bachelor's before the end of the application deadline you have to prove that you can realistically expect to finish it before the start of the master's program.
Knowledge of practical laboratory work equivalent to 20 CP must be providеd.
GPA (German System) 2.70
GPA Comment
Minimum grade of 2.7 required in Bachelor's degree (Biology, or Geology with strong focus on Palaeontology). English proficiency required at B2 level (TOEFL iBT 79, IELTS 6.0, or 7 years of English at European high school or equiνalеnt).

Application Documents
The following documents will be requested from you during the application process:
CV.
Scanned transcripts of the bachelor's degree, transcript of the master's degree (if available) and respective diploma, including secondary school diploma.
Proof of proficiency in English (see language requirements).
Letter of motivation.
Copy of your passport.
Please upload all requested documents in one zip-file (max. file size: 4 MΒ).
